Cinnamon Roll Bundt Cake With Cream Cheese Frosting

Updated: Dec. 23, 2025

Recipe Details

  • Total Time: 3 hours (includes cooling)

  • Prep Time: 30 minutes

  • Cook Time: 1 hour 30 minutes (plus cooling)

Ingredients

Cinnamon Crumbs

  • 2 tablespoons unsalted butter

  • ⅓ cup (28g) panko bread crumbs

  • ⅔ cup (150g) packed dark brown sugar

  • 5 teaspoons ground cinnamon

  • Pinch of fine sea salt

Cake Batter

  • 2 cups (260g) all-purpose flour

  • 1½ cups (300g) granulated sugar

  • 1½ teaspoons baking powder

  • ¾ teaspoon fine sea salt

  • 5 large eggs

  • 1 tablespoon vanilla extract

  • ¾ cup (168g) unsalted butter, cubed, room temperature

  • 6 ounces (169g) cream cheese, cubed, room temperature

Cream Cheese Frosting

  • 10 ounces (290g) cream cheese, softened

  • 2 tablespoons (28g) unsalted butter, softened

  • ¾ cup (85g) powdered sugar, plus extra for adjusting sweetness

  • Pinch of fine sea salt

  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ract

Equipment

  • 9-inch Bundt pan (preferably metal)

  • Nonstick baking spray

  • Stand mixer (with paddle attachment) or hand mixer

  • Offset spatula, skewer/cake tester, cooling rack

Preparation Steps

Step 1: Prepare Cinnamon Crumbs

Heat butter in a nonstick skillet over medium heat until fully melted and foaming. Add panko bread crumbs and stir continuously with a heat-resistant spatula for 3–4 minutes until evenly golden brown. Transfer to a bowl, add brown sugar, cinnamon, and salt, then mix thoroughly. Allow to cool completely to room temperature (prevents overheating the batter).

Step 2: Preheat & Prepare Bundt Pan

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Coat the 9-inch Bundt pan with nonstick baking spray, ensuring all surfaces (including the center tube) are evenly coated to prevent sticking.

Step 3: Mix Dry & Wet Ingredients

In the bowl of a stand mixer, whisk together flour, granulated sugar, baking powder, and salt on low speed for 1 minute to break up clumps and aerate. In a separate bowl, whisk eggs and vanilla extract until smooth.

Step 4: Cream & Incorporate Batter

Add room-temperature butter and cream cheese cubes to the dry ingredients. With the mixer on low speed, pulse for 1–2 minutes until the mixture resembles coarse crumbs. Gradually pour the egg-vanilla mixture in a steady stream while mixing, stopping halfway to scrape the bowl. Continue mixing on medium speed for 30 seconds, then medium-high for 1 minute to achieve a smooth, airy batter.

Step 5: Layer Batter & Crumbs

To build the cinnamon roll effect:

  1. Distribute ¼ of the batter into the Bundt pan, spreading into a thin, even layer with an offset spatula.

  2. Sprinkle ⅓ of the cinnamon crumbs evenly over the batter.

  3. Add another ¼ of batter, spreading to fill gaps and reach the edges.

  4. Repeat with remaining batter and crumbs, finishing with a final crumb layer on top.

Step 6: Bake & Cool

Bake for 60–70 minutes until a skewer inserted into the center emerges with a few moist crumbs. Cool in the pan for 15 minutes, then invert onto a cooling rack to finish cooling (1–2 hours).

Step 7: Frosting Preparation

In a stand mixer, beat softened cream cheese and butter on medium-high speed for 2–3 minutes until smooth. Add powdered sugar, salt, and vanilla; mix on low for 30 seconds, then medium-high for 1–2 minutes until fluffy. Adjust sweetness with extra powdered sugar if needed.

Step 8: Assemble & Store

Frost the cooled cake immediately with cream cheese frosting. For a glossy finish, spread evenly or pipe in swirls. Store in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days or refrigerate for 5 days.

Recipe Tips & Reader Reviews

Author’s Note

"Traditional method: Combine wet ingredients (eggs, vanilla, butter, cream cheese) in one bowl; dry ingredients (flour, sugar, baking powder, salt) in another. Mix dry into wet by hand until just combined—minimizes mess and ensures tenderness."

Cook’s Notes from Readers

  • Baking Time Adjustment: "Using a Nordic Ware Bundt pan, the cake finished in 1 hour. Test doneness at 50 minutes to avoid over-baking; 5 large eggs (extra-large) worked well."

  • Pan Substitution: "A rectangular metal pan works; use thinner layers and reduce baking to 35–40 minutes (glass/ceramic pans alter heat distribution)."

  • Texture Fix: "Triple the cinnamon crumb mixture (panko + brown sugar) for balance; the crumbs add crunch without excess sweetness."

  • Frosting Hack: "Frost while warm for a drizzled effect; refrigerated frosting stays soft but thickens with time."
